package org.apache.uima.internal.util;
import java.io.File;
import java.net.MalformedURLException;
import java.net.URL;
import java.net.URLClassLoader;
import java.util.ArrayList;
import java.util.StringTokenizer;
/**
* UIMAClassLoader is used as extension ClassLoader for UIMA to load additional components like
* annotators and resources. The classpath of the classloader is specified as string.
*
* The strategy for this ClassLoader tries to load the class itself before the classloading is
* delegated to the application class loader.
*
*/
public class UIMAClassLoader extends URLClassLoader {
/**
* Transforms the string classpath to and URL array based classpath.
*
* The classpath string must be separated with the filesystem path separator.
*
* @param classpath
* a classpath string
* @return URL[] array of wellformed URL's
* @throws MalformedURLException
* if a malformed URL has occurred in the classpath string.
*/
public static URL[] transformClasspath(String classpath) throws MalformedURLException {
// initialize StringTokenizer to separate the classpath
StringTokenizer tok = new StringTokenizer(classpath, File.pathSeparator);
// pathList of the classpath entries
ArrayList pathList = new ArrayList();
// extract all classpath entries and add them to the pathList
while (tok.hasMoreTokens()) {
pathList.add(tok.nextToken());
}
final int max = pathList.size();
URL[] urlArray = new URL[max];
// transform all classpath entries to an URL and add them to an URL array
for (int i = 0; i < max; i++) {
urlArray[i] = (new File((String) pathList.get(i))).toURI().toURL();
// calling toURI() first handles spaces in classpath
}
return urlArray;
}

/*
* Try to load the class itself before delegate the class loading to its parent
*/
protected synchronized Class loadClass(String name, boolean resolve)
throws ClassNotFoundException {
// First, check if the class has already been loaded
Class c = findLoadedClass(name);
if (c == null) {
try {
// try to load class
c = findClass(name);
} catch (ClassNotFoundException e) {
// delegate class loading for clas
c = super.loadClass(name, false);
}
}
if (resolve) {
resolveClass(c);
}
return c;
}
}
